The Design And Realization Of The Power Supervising & Controlling System Of Substation

Today, electricity as an energy is getting more and more important in people's daily life, to improve reliability of power supply is the power supply enterprises' major problem. As a centralized and decentralized power point, enhancing the reliability of power supply is a key point for continuous power supply problem. Beside, for all types of enterprises hunter for higher level of communication quality, stability and reliability, especially those factory or substation which use the PC to supervising and controlling the equipment, the accurate and reliable of the data is more important. This thesis start with the reality, use a substation of Fu Shun as the implementation object, do some research in the construction of the power supervising and controlling system of substation.The thesis base on the request of the factory, do some analysis in the whole supervising and control system, and devide the system into three parts, partition floor, communicate floor and control floor, made the choice for the device which the substation needed, so constitute the basic hardware structure. The research about the principle and protocol of data communication among the supervising and control unit, communication regulator and protective relay units is also made in this section. Based on the multi-thread mechanism, the monitoring software implement the parallel running between the background data communication and the foreground operation that insured the real time characteristic of the system. Design out a suit of substation supervise and control system with high accurate and reliability, realize the remote control, remote monitor, remote measure, remote adjust of four remote's basic function which the substation needed. Beside, we work out the report form which is important to the factory, record the history data of the key equipment and draw out the history curve of some data. After that, recording to the history database of the supervising & controlling system, we do the reactive power compensate for the equipment and achieve the optimization operation. Through the test of the function of the supervising & controlling system, with the date of the supervising and controlling picture, we can make the conclusion, the supervising & controlling system which we design is reliable, accurate, generally apply with simple structure, easy expand, operate conveniently, man-machine interface friendly and so on.At the last of the thesis, we make a summarization of some problems in the process of design, and give some measures for the relevant problem. Then show the author's prospect of the power supervising and controlling system.
